I wanted to edit menu.lst for boot that used to be in /boot/grub dir in earlier versions ubuntu. I can not find it . Where is the file located or if the name changed what is the file ?

Ubuntu now uses grub2 which uses /boot/grub/grub.cfg

Editting this file is futile as the file is generated using scripts and other configs, you CAN edit the file but next time you instal a new kernel, the change will be wiped, to make youor changes permanent you need to add the settings you wish in Grub2's scripts and config files so that when new kernels are installed you will not lose the settings.
